Briana was born in Fort Morgan, Colorado on July 14, 1987. She comes from a farming background where three generations of Kroskobs have toiled the land. She learned how to ride when she was five and became the owner of her first horse, a grey pony named Smokey, when she was seven, which she bought with the help of her father and savings from her weekly allowance. In sixth grade, she began her career, showing her second horse, a white Arabian named Quaema. Since then she has owned a number of different horses and worked with a number of different breeds until finally deciding to concentrate her efforts to the Paint Horse breed. In 2002, she acquired Mr. Genuine Dun, who before to long, was the 2003 High Point Yearling Stallion with three grands and seven reserves.
Briana will be graduating High School in 2005. She is an active member in FFA doing Ag Business, Parli Pro, Horse Judging and Public Speaking. She has also started roping, barrel racing as well as taking lessons in English. She plans to attend CSU or CU Davis for Equine Management and Equine Science.
